WebJul 29, 2008 · Scientists had identified that there were particular types of chemicals called bases that were found in DNA. These bases were Adenine (abbreviated as A), Thymine (T), Guanine (G) and Cytosine (C). These bases are found in the centre of a DNA molecule. However, scientists were not sure how they would be arranged in a DNA molecule.
